April 4, 2026 - Durham, North Carolina - A seven-run run fifth inning was too much for the Lehigh Valley IronPigs (6-2) to overcome in a 9-7 loss to the Durham Bulls (2-6) on Saturday night at Durham Bulls Athletic Park.
Two-run homers from Garrett Stubbs in the second and Bryan De La Cruz in the third put the 'Pigs on top 4-2 after Durham plated a pair in the first.
In the fifth, Durham grinded out seven free passes en route to scoring seven runs, all with two outs, on the strength of just two hits in the inning.

April 3, 2026 - Durham, North Carolina - On the strength of five-run frames in the seventh and eighth innings, the Lehigh Valley IronPigs (6-1) turned a 5-0 deficit into an eventual 10-6 win over the Durham Bulls (1-6) on Friday night at Durham Bulls Athletic Park.

April 2, 2026 - Durham, North Carolina - Alan Rangel, Griff McGarry, Lou Trivino, and Chase Shugart combined to twirl a gem as the Lehigh Valley IronPigs (5-1) shutout the Durham Bulls (1-4) by a final of 4-0 on Thursday night at Durham Bulls Athletic Park.
The only offense the 'Pigs needed came courtesy of a Garrett Stubbs three-run homer in the second inning and a Robert Moore RBI double in the fifth.

April 1, 2026 - Durham, North Carolina - The Lehigh Valley IronPigs (4-1) dropped their first game of the season, a 6-1 loss to the Durham Bulls (1-4), on Wednesday night at Durham Bulls Athletic Park.
A two-out rally in the first inning stole two runs for the Bulls. A perfectly executed double steal allowed Justyn-Henry Malloy to scamper home with the game's first run before Jacob Melton scored on an error to make it 2-0.

The Lehigh Valley IronPigs are an affiliated minor league baseball team. Based in Allentown, Pennsylvania, they are a member of the International League.
